the 2900xt has 512mb, the 2900xtx has 1gb of ram, but also costs a lot more then 400$. According to this: http://www.xbitlabs.com/articl...8-roundup_9.html#sect1 the 8800gts 320mb performs the same in 1900*1200 as the 8800gts 640mb. The 2900xt performs equal to or better then the 8800gts 640mb, and sometimes is as fast as the 8800gtx.

Personaly, with a 7900gt, I would hold of a little longer, unless it is really struggling with your new monitor. Or go with a 8800gts 320mb, and use the stepup program to buy a better card in 3 months.
